Cut Out presents the previously untold relationship between
photography, feminist art and collage, from the 19th century to the
present day.Female artists have long employed collage to reflect
the ways in which identity is often constructed from conflicting,
contrasting and contradictory parts. Cut Out explores the
relationship between photography and feminist collage,
foregrounding the use of femmage – a radical reclaiming of craft
traditionally associated with women – as a resilient method within
feminist and political art.Cut Out presents an expanded definition
of collage and cutting techniques to encompass photomontage,
assemblage and the photogram. Tracing a lineage from
nineteenth-century makers to contemporary practitioners, we
encounter Victorian album makers, Modernist, Surrealist and Dadaist
innovators, and radical, second-wave feminist artists. Thematic
sections include profiles written by expert contributors on key
individuals, including Hannah Höch, Dora Maar and Lorna Simpson.
Looking to the future as much as the past, Cut Out also reveals how
the pioneering work of contemporary and digital artists continues
to subvert dominant narratives and foster ever-expanding forms of
photographic collage. At a moment when photography and its history
are being actively contested and reappraised, Cut Out is a reminder
of its political power.
